Framatome is an international leader in nuclear energy recognized for its innovative, digital and value added solutions for the global nuclear fleet. With worldwide expertise and a proven track record for reliability and performance, the company designs, services and installs components, fuel, and instrumentation and control systems for nuclear power plants. Its more than employees work every day to help Framatome's customers supply ever cleaner, safer and more economical low-carbon energy. Visit us at, and follow us on Twitter: @Framatome_ and LinkedIn: Framatome.

Framatome is owned by the EDF Group (80.5%) and Mitsubishi Heavy Industries (MHI – 19.5%).

Job description


The planned working pattern will be to carry out the following:

· Support the SZB Outage (scheduled for every 18 months for a 6-to-12-week period).

· Working in the SZB Maintenance Department.

· Work on overseas Outages in various countries including Finland, South Africa, Brazil etc.

Key responsibilities will include:

· Support refuelling and maintenance outages, including reactor loading and unloading activities.

· Operate specialised fuel handling equipment and machinery to move, install and remove nuclear fuel assemblies.

· Perform routine equipment checks, preventive maintenance, and report defects or abnormalities.

· Work closely with engineering, operations and radiation protection teams to ensure compliance and operational excellence.

· Participate in ongoing training, including specialised training coursers overseas.

· Adhere to procedures, relevant quality procedures and assist with quality records and documentation.

· Maintain equipment and small tools for assembly / calibration.

· Perform leak detection, pressure testing and integrity assessments of Nuclear Steam Supply Systems (NSSS).
